What is Axenic?
Axenic operates at the intersection of advanced materials science and telecommunications, specializing in the design, development, and production of sophisticated optical modulators. By leveraging high-performance materials such as Gallium Arsenide and Indium Phosphide, the company provides essential components for demanding environments, including defense, satellite, and aerospace communications. Their service model spans the entire product lifecycle, from initial concept validation and custom device prototyping to full-scale production and engineering consultancy. How much funding has Axenic raised?
Axenic has raised a total of $674K across 1 funding round:
Other Financing Round
$674K
Other Financing Round (2025): $674K with participation from Maven Equity Partners
